Web10 jan. 2024 · Chronic lymphocytic leukaemia (CLL) is an indolent haematological cancer that occurs with increasing age. Usually presents with absolute lymphocytosis as an incidental finding on routine full blood count (FBC) or with asymptomatic lymphadenopathy. Diagnosed by FBC with differential, blood smear showing smudge cells, and flow cytometry. WebThis test measures the level of lactate dehydrogenase (LDH), also known as lactic acid dehydrogenase, in your blood or sometimes in other body fluids. LDH is a type of protein, known as an enzyme. LDH plays an important role in making your body's energy. It is found in almost all the body's tissues, including those in the blood, heart, kidneys ... Web22 mrt. 2024 · Chronic lymphocytic leukemia (CLL) is a malignancy of CD 5-positive B cells that is characterized by the accumulation of small, mature-appearing neoplastic lymphocytes in the blood, bone marrow, and secondary lymphoid tissues. This results in lymphocytosis, infiltration of the marrow, lymphadenopathy, and splenomegaly.
